## Deployment

Alertfold is the dedupe layer sitting between Pagemuster and the on-call rotation, so please don't ship it mid-incident. Roll it out to the canary pool first, watch suppression rates for ten minutes, then promote. Rollbacks are one command via the deploy bot. Before promoting, double-check the service is running with these configuration values.

service settings:
[druvan]
port = 8000
team = gorir
host = druvan.paliqworks.corp
region = central-1
access_code = ac_0d333e
timeout_ms = 1000

Subject: DR Drill Recap — Stale-Cache Postmortem Follow-up. Team, ahead of the weekly sync: Thursday's disaster-recovery drill exercised the fix from the Pellgrove stale-cache incident. We confirmed the cache invalidation fence now propagates within four seconds under simulated region loss. One gap remains: the drill coordinator account. To complete failover sign-off, the coordinator console must be unlocked with the passphrase below.

vault phrase of taweg-kafof = oliax-zorael

Welcome to the assistant crew at Bramblewick Studios! One of your regular tasks is booking the wellness room on level 3 for your team. It's first-come-first-served in the Quillhub calendar, so grab slots early — Mondays fill up fast. Sessions run 30 minutes max, and please wipe down the mats after yoga bookings (the bin of wipes lives by the window). The room stays locked outside bookings, so you'll need the door-pass to let people in. Here's the code you'll use:

staff pass of kagup-fajog = bdg-QCHVQW-99665837

Dedupe lag on Klaxonette alerts. If duplicates page twice, the fingerprint cache on the Brimward cluster likely evicted early. Check cache TTL against the alert flood window; bump to 15m if needed. Restart only the dedup worker, not the router. Confirm the fix by replaying the last storm, then record the build token shown here.

build token for haduf-bafog: htk21_2d98ce91a83676b65394a